Posted something along these lines previously, but have now figured out a good solution to it!


Ok, so our more skilled musicians have started getting a tad frustrated when musicians who can only play SW1 or 2 have been joining our band in the evenings, as it slows down their xp very much. (This must be true because I am a dancer and was about 5k behind a musician in hitting novice status last night, but since he had to play a couple songs below his skill level, even with a fizz, I still ended up beating him to the novice level.) At one point I went outside to dance in the streets because, if you haven't seen, formal dancing takes up MUCHO space and I needed a change of scenery to boot. What I noticed as I walked around was that as long as my group members' health/action/mind bars were visible in the group window (and still displayed in red/green/blue format) was that I got the bonus xp of being in the group, even though I was out of listening range!


What does this mean to young musicians? If my theory is correct, which I assume it is since grouping seems to work the same for dancers and musicians, you can join a higher level band, walk outside of listening range, and begin playing! You may even be able to sneak towards the very far end of the bar and be in a spot that you can not be heard and still get healing points, but I haven't tried that.
